Allan and Violetta Coe won an estimated $1 million through the Western Max lottery on April 19 after purchasing a ticket in Creighton. - PHOTO COURTESY SASKATCHEWAN LOTTERIES

When Violetta Coe and her son called her husband Allan to tell him she had won the April 19 Western Max lottery, he had a short but descriptive response.

“He asked me if I was sitting down,” Allan said. “He told me what we won, and all I could think of to say was, ‘Bull–!’”.

The Coes became the north’s newest millionaires by winning $1 million with a ticket she purchased at the Creighton Petro Canada station.

“I checked my ticket on the mobile app,” said Coe. “At first, I thought it said $1,000. Then I thought it said $10,000.”

“I called my son over to look at the number for me. He paused a minute, sat down and said, ‘Mom, you won a million dollars!’ We couldn’t believe it.”

The Coes are the first couple to receive a major lottery win in the Flin Flon-Creighton area since Bill McLean won $100,000 through Lotto 6/49 in 2016.

“When Al got home, he looked at me and said, ‘I told you our ship would come in,’” said Violetta. “He was right – our ship has come in!”

As far as the future goes, Vi and Al are keeping their options open. According to a news release from Saskatchewan Lotteries, the Coes have not announced what they hope to do with the money.
